## Ownership

The catalogue import pipeline for the Wrenhollow Library system is maintained by the Data Intake squad. It ingests nightly record feeds, normalises them, and writes to the Shelfstone index. New team members should not modify mapping rules without review. For access requests or import failures, contact the owner listed below.

account owner for bawip-tahag: Raleth Quenok

Welcome to on-call for the Glimmerpane design system! Our snapshot tests live in the `snapcheck` suite and run on every merge to main. If a UI component changes visually, the diff bot flags it — usually it's an intentional tweak, so just approve the new baseline. If it's 2am and snapshots are failing across the board, it's almost always a font-loading race, not your problem. To unlock the baseline store and re-approve snapshots in bulk, use the recovery passphrase below.

recovery phrase for tahag-taguf: wenix-caswyn

Ticket: Missed Pick-up — Sealed Bid

Scheduled collection of the sealed tender envelope for the Dunmore Works bid did not occur today. Envelope remains in the locked drawer at the Kellport front desk. Submission deadline is Thursday 10:00. Rebook pick-up for tomorrow, first slot. Driver must not open or re-label the envelope and must record hand-off time on the ticket. The confidential courier hand-over instruction follows immediately below.

dispatch memo: the sorox briiel courier leaves the druius kelion fenir gorvan ralael rusius julwyn belwyn ledger at gate 4220 under passcode 637242

OFF-SITE RUN — CHECKLIST ITEM 7 (Records Team)

Item: crate of survey instruments, Thornquist Mapping return batch.
Verify crate seals against the manifest before release. Instruments are calibrated — no stacking, keep upright, padded straps only. Photograph all six faces for the file. Custody form signed at release and at receipt, no exceptions. Collection window is Friday, first run, loading dock two. Record the crate weight in the ledger. The courier hand-over instruction follows below.

handover note for yagef-bagep: the drudor pelius courier leaves the kasdor zorvan norir ledger at gate 8016 under passcode 755406